So it's not in reddish brown after all, just old brown? Well if that is the case, then it kind of sucks... pirate_classic.gif Theoretically, this hull piece is not available in reddish brown.

Why theoretically? Well, this preliminary picture shows that at one point the Viking ship was supposed to use the old version of the LEGO Pirates hull in what seems to be (light?) grey top and reddish brown bottom (after all, Vikings were released in the bley/reddish brown era). The final version has a completely different hull obviously, but who knows? Perhaps a reddish brown version of that hull made specifically for that prototype exists somewhere in the LEGO headquarters. pir_laugh2.gif
